Answer #1

1. A confidence interval is a statistical interval around a point estimate that we can provide a level of confidence to for capturing the true population parameter.

Confidence interval gives us the interval within which the parameter falls with a certain level of confidence

2. Which of the following best describe the standard error of the mean?

It is the standard deviation of the sampling distribution of the mean.

The standard error of the mean is standard deviation of the mean of the sampling distribution

3. Which of the following is NOT a true statement?

All of these statements about the t distribution are true

All the given statements are true.

4. What is the first step a researcher takes in hypothesis testing?

State the null and alternative hypothesis

The first step in hypothesis testing is stating the null and alternate hypothesis, based on which we calculate the test statistic, p value and then make a decision

5. Which of the following is NOT an accurate or true statement?

When conducting statistical tests, we always assume the alternative hypothesis is true in the population

The above statement is incorrect. Since we assume that the null hypothesis is correct and then with that assumption we try and reject the null hypothesis
